Title: Cyanazine
CAS Registry Number: 21725-46-2
CAS Name: 2-[[4-Chloro-6-(ethylamino)-1,3,5-triazin-2-yl]amino]-2-methylpropanenitrile
Synonyms: 2-[[4-chloro-6-(ethylamino)-s-triazin-2-yl]amino]-2-methylpropionitrile
Manufacturers' Codes: SD-15418; WL-19805; DW-3418
Trademarks: Bladex (Shell); Fortrol (Shell)
Molecular Formula: C9H13ClN6
Molecular Weight: 240.69
Percent Composition: C 44.91%, H 5.44%, Cl 14.73%, N 34.92%
Literature References: Selective pre-emergence herbicide. Prepn: GB 1132306; W. Schwarze, US 3505325 (1968, 1970 both to Degussa). Activity: T. Chapman et al., Proc. 9th Br. Weed Control Conf. 2, 1018 (1968). Metabolism: J. V. Crayford, D. H. Hutson, Pestic. Biochem. Physiol. 2, 295 (1975). Persistence in soil: J. T. Majka, T. L. Lavy, Weed Sci. 25, 401 (1977).
Properties: White crystals, mp 167.5-169°. Vapor pressure at 20°: 1.6 ′ 10-9 mmHg. Soly in water at 25°: 171 mg/l. Soly at 25° (g/l): benzene 15, chloroform 210, ethanol 45, hexane 15. LD50 in rats, mice (mg/kg): 182, 380 orally (Chapman).
Melting point: mp 167.5-169°
Toxicity data: LD50 in rats, mice (mg/kg): 182, 380 orally (Chapman)
Use: Herbicide.
